The original finding aid described this as:
Description: View of the unfurlled solar arrays on the Hubble Space Telescope (HST) by the STS-109 crew. The HST is berthed in the Columbia's payload bay. The Remote Manipulator System (RMS) end effector is visible in the upper right corner. An Earth limb forms the background.
